The verdict is in – society is moving toward a cashless future. According to a recent report by Visa, a mere 11% of consumers prefer cash payments to credit. This number will only decrease as members of Gen Z join the workforce and start to make financial decisions in today’s world. In fact, an Accenture survey found that “68% of Gen Z consumers are interested in instant person-to person payments – more than any other age group.” Credit unions must fervently answer this call and strategically plan for changing demographics and their dynamic needs.
